Description Couret Charles-Antoine 2010-09-11 09:04:59 UTC
Description of problem:
I installed the Meego's group package.
With KDM, I would launch Meego but I see the cursor in Meego's theme but after few seconds, X is reloads and I see KDM…

I can't use Meego with my machine.

How reproducible:
Install Meego and launch it with KDM or GDM…

Additional info:
I use Fedora 14 x86_64 with nVidia cards (and nouveau driver). It's the reason ? Because I know Meego is optimized to ARM or Atom and no nVidia and consorts… But if Meego couldn't use with this hardware, it should be noted.
